Leading sustainability consultancy Tunley Environmental has released its 2025 Sustainability Report, delivering an in-depth analysis of the year’s pivotal advancements in climate action, biodiversity, regulatory evolution, and corporate sustainability performance. The report outlines industry progress while underscoring pressing challenges that will define environmental policies and business strategies in 2026 and beyond.
Authored by Tunley’s team of scientists and sustainability experts, the report offers sector-wide insights rooted in scientific analysis, data scrutiny, and real-world client experiences. It reflects Tunley Environmental’s ongoing dedication to aiding organisations as they adapt to changing expectations around carbon disclosure, nature stewardship, and supply chain transparency.
Key highlights from the 2025 report include major sustainability shifts such as advancements in carbon reduction, renewable energy, climate adaptation, and the integration of biodiversity into corporate governance. It also provides an overview of the evolving regulatory landscape, featuring updates related to the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ive (CSRD), the UK’s PPN 006, global biodiversity frameworks, and the latest standards from the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i). Additionally, it details Tunley Environmental’s impact through their knowledge-sharing efforts, including free sustainability webinars and guides, and insights from COP 30 focusing on nature-positive pathways and climate resilience financing.
